MindShift CBT spends techniques of cognitive behavioral medication, or CBT, to assist users manage symptoms of nervousness or be concerned. Cognitive behavioural treatment therapy is a kind of proof-mainly based treatment one plans imagine activities one negatively connect with someone’s practices and you can feelings. By taking and you may challenging malicious consider models, you can then exchange all of them with even more self-confident and you will practical viewpoint. Getting started off with MindShift CBT

The app’s step-by-step rules, comforting shade, and you will structured style set it up except that almost every other apps, such Peaceful and you can Happify, that will appear overwhelming at first glance. And additionally, MindShift CBT is free of charge in order to obtain and rehearse which will be offered for apple’s ios and you can Android os, growing the access to beyond that of their opposition.

Whenever i earliest launched new application, I happened to be greeted by the Check-In page, that is essentially a vibe tracker. I am able to disperse brand new slider right up or down to explain my personal aura at that time, ranging from a beneficial and you may high in order to ok so you can awful. Once i registered my personal see-inside every day, I found myself prompted to price my personal anxiety into a scale out of 0 so you can ten, determine that was happening at that moment, and you can include just what apparent symptoms of nervousness I found myself sense in the date. The symptoms was indeed when you look at the a checklist structure and included physical and you can mental attacks, such as a race cardio, dry lips, problems concentrating, additionally the craving to stop/avoid.
